A Champion with Titanic Volume

The verdict is in: Shaun Deeb is the 2025 WSOP Player of the Year, a crowning achievement that rewards a phenomenal season in which the American dominated the leaderboard thanks to his remarkable consistency. Already victorious in 2018, Deeb becomes only the second player in history, after Daniel Negreanu, to win this prestigious award twice.
With 4,194 points accumulated, he narrowly edged out England’s Benny Glaser (4,153 points), who still captured three bracelets this year. The podium is completed by Michael Mizrachi (3,805 points), winner of the Main Event and four-time Poker Players Championship champion, who was inducted into the Hall of Fame at the end of the festival. A trio that truly dominated the summer.
But Deeb didn’t stumble into this title. 24 cashes, five final tables, and one bracelet in a historic event: the first-ever $100,000 Pot-Limit Omaha tournament. Most notably, he took home a record-setting prize of $2,957,229, the largest ever awarded in a PLO tournament.
In addition to that, he also finished runner-up three times: in the $1,500 Razz, the $600 Online Monster Stack, and the $1,000 No-Limit Hold’em. He also took third place in the $10,000 PLO8 Championship for $348,304. A scorching summer, to say the least.
On social media, Deeb acknowledged his rivals Martin Kabrhel and Benny Glaser for their fierce battle until the very last event. To those questioning his title — arguing that Mizrachi or Glaser were more deserving — he answered plainly: “Everyone got what they earned.” It’s hard to disagree.
The 2025 record confirms Shaun Deeb’s unique stature in the global poker scene. At 39, he now owns seven bracelets, over $4 million earned this summer, and a well-deserved place among the game’s all-time greats.
